Position Summary

Bear Business Finance Ltd is hiring for an Executive Finance Broker to join their fast-growing team. As an Executive Finance Broker, your main responsibility will be to generate new business by contacting potential clients through outbound calls, outlining Bear Business Finances’ financial solutions to the clients, and educating them on the benefits of asset finance and commercial loan funding. Whilst working through the ‘Centre of Excellence programme' you will be working closely with a Director or Senior Finance Broker. Once you have qualified an opportunity, you will work alongside a Director or Senior Finance Broker to progress it through to completion.

Key Duties

  • Generate new business through a combination of outbound prospecting, marketing-generated leads, and warm enquiries, building strong relationships with prospective clients to grow your future customer base while supporting both your own and your mentor's pipeline.
  • You will take a consultative approach, qualifying the customers’ requirements to understand their business finance needs and link them to the suitability of Bear Business Finances’ solutions on offer.
  • Read and understand company financials, via online software and manually reading business accounts, you will be trained on this.
  • Compose proposal documentation and funder applications, this will include document gathering from clients and learning their business model.
  • Continually and consistently generate a pipeline of leads for you and your Senior Finance Broker.
  • Report directly to a Director or Senior Finance Broker and respond to all requests made in line with their position and hierarchical seniority.

Compensation

The salary package is made up of a basic salary and a commission bonus totalling a realistic first year OTE of £65,000 - £120,000 and second year of £150,000+. During your first three months, while completing our Centre of Excellence Programme, we guarantee a pro rata salary equivalent to £40,000 - £45,000 per annum.

Career Development

Our Executive Finance Broker position is part of our ‘Centre of Excellence’ programme. This programme forms a long-term career strategy that our successful candidates will follow, with a view of developing into a fully fledged finance broker within 3 months. Our centre of excellence programme provides our Brokers with:

  • Director mentorship, development, training, and support from a Finance Expert.
  • Working closely with a Director or senior finance broker.
  • Centre of Excellence clear path, with regular signposted targets and objectives.
  • Market-leading commission structure on completion of the Centre of Excellence Programme– we want the best, so we pay the best.
  • On completion of the Centre of Excellence Programme, we expect our candidates to be earning a realistic OTE of circa £150,000+ per year from year 2 onwards.
